Four children drown in Yamuna river in Fatehpur

KANPUR: In a tragic incident, four children drowned to death while taking bath after immersing 'puja' material in Yamuna river on Saturday at Mauhari Ghat under Kishnupur police area of Fatehpur district.


Bhoori (14), her sister Prabhawati (12), their neighbours Preeti (14) and Prince (12), all natives of Maholi Ka Dera Majre Raipur Bharsaul village under the limits of Kishnupur police area of the district had gone to immerse 'puja' material along with other villagers in Yamuna river at Mauhari Ghat of the district.


"It was when they were taking bath in river Yamuna, they went into deep water and drowned," said an eyewitnesses.


The district administration soon launched a rescue operation with the help of police teams and divers. "Bodies of four were fished out and handed over to their parents after postmortem," said Circle Officer Surendra Kumar.
